Taxonomy Lipids and lipid-like molecules > Prenol lipids > Diterpenoids
IUPAC Name 5-(2,5,5,8a-tetramethyl-3,4,4a,6,7,8-hexahydronaphthalen-1-yl)-3-methylpent-2-en-1-ol
SMILES (Canonical) CC1=C(C2(CCCC(C2CC1)(C)C)C)CCC(=CCO)C
SMILES (Isomeric) CC1=C(C2(CCCC(C2CC1)(C)C)C)CCC(=CCO)C
InChI InChI=1S/C20H34O/c1-15(11-14-21)7-9-17-16(2)8-10-18-19(3,4)12-6-13-20(17,18)5/h11,18,21H,6-10,12-14H2,1-5H3
InChI Key IOHVFDUBRDGOCE-UHFFFAOYSA-N

Physical and Chemical Properties

Top
Molecular Formula C20H34O
Molecular Weight 290.50 g/mol
Exact Mass 290.260965704 g/mol
Topological Polar Surface Area (TPSA) 20.20 Ų
XlogP 5.50
Atomic LogP (AlogP) 5.65
H-Bond Acceptor 1
H-Bond Donor 1
Rotatable Bonds 4
